Family tours of the exhibition
le19M x Clarisse Aïn
Designed for visitors of all ages, the Saturday afternoon family tours offer a fun and immersive approach to the exhibition Beyond our Horizons: from Tokyo to Paris, celebrating the creative dialogue between Japanese and French artisans and designers.
In small groups, accompanied by a guide, children (ages 6 and up) and their parents are invited to explore the exhibition and interact freely with its themes.
The second part of the family visit provides an introduction to the savoir-faire of the Métiers d’art through the presentation of a 19M Métiers d’art kit. The presentation lasts 15 minutes.
Designed in collaboration with le19M’s resident Maisons d’art, the 19M Métiers d’art kits offer visitors a chance to discover the exceptional savoir-faire behind each craft creation, using tools, samples, and step-by-step instructions.
They offer a creative and sensory exploration of materials and provide a rare opportunity to get up close and personal with the savoir-faire behind the work, with each participant playing an active role in the process.
